#a9c397 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a9c397 is composed of 66.3% red, 76.5%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.6%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 95.5 degrees, a saturation of 26.8% and a lightness of 67.8%. #a9c397 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#53872f.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#a9c397 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a9c397 has RGB values of R:169, G:195,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 11125655.

Hex triplet a9c397 #a9c397
RGB Decimal 169, 195, 151 rgb(169,195,151)
RGB Percent 66.3, 76.5, 59.2 rgb(66.3%,76.5%,59.2%)
CMYK 13, 0, 23, 24
HSL 95.5°, 26.8, 67.8 hsl(95.5,26.8%,67.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 95.5°, 22.6, 76.5
Web Safe 99cc99 #99cc99
CIE-LAB 75.884, -16.848, 19.253
XYZ 41.462, 49.699, 36.685
xyY 0.324, 0.389, 49.699
CIE-LCH 75.884, 25.584, 131.189
CIE-LUV 75.884, -12.774, 29.906
Hunter-Lab 70.498, -18.389, 18.495
Binary 10101001, 11000011, 10010111

Shades and Tints of #a9c397

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060805 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a9c397 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b6b6b6 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b3b9b0 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#cabe98 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#dab7a0 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#b6bfcd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#bebf98 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c8bb9d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#b1c0b9 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
